Meow Wolf, the immersive, experiential entertainment company building fantastical storytelling-led installations in cities across the U.S., has found a new CEO after a nearly year-long search.

Matthew Henick, most recently senior VP at The Trade Desk and a veteran of Deep Voodoo, Meta, Epic Games, and BuzzFeed, will lead the company, which is behind installations like Omega Mart in Las Vegas. Meow Wolf is set to open a new experience in Los Angeles later this year set in a former movie theater. It is planning an exhibition in New York in 2027.

With Henick’s hiring, Rebecca Campbell, the former Disney executive who stepped in as interim CEO a year ago, will return to her previous role as a board member for the company.
